Abstract
In this paper, a novel personal telerobotic system named "telecommunicator" is introduced. It has a movable head with a video camera and a simple arm. Both the head and the arm can be telecontrolled from the local site through the Internet, using a wireless communication link just as for mobile cellular phones. As a result, the person on the local site can communicate with people around the telecommunicator on the remote site. The telecommunicator can be made small and compact, since it is not expected to achieve any physical task but only communication. Two different forms of the telecommunicator are proposed; a wearable one and a mobile one. Furthermore, to achieve good performance of the telecommunicator, a new concept called "extended shared control" is introduced. In addition, to confirm its application capacity, two prototypes of the wearable telecommunicator, T1 and T2, have been developed as research platforms.
